===Historical Background===
*The first '''Catholic''' parish was founded at Red River in 1818 by two priests.
*The '''Church of England (Anglican)''' began in the same area in 1820.
*The '''Methodists''' were established at Rossville in 1840.
*The '''Presbyterians first arrived in Assiniboin in 1851.
*'''Baptists, Lutherans, and Mennonites''' were established in Manitoba in the 1870s as a result of the arrival of large numbers of Germanic and Slavic immigrants.
*The Congregationalists, Methodists, and some of the Presbyterians were combined in 1925 to form the '''United Church of Canada'''.
